Mastering Excel: How to Connect One Excel File to Another

Excel is an incredibly powerful tool for data management, and one of its most useful features is the ability to connect multiple files. This capability allows users to consolidate data from different workbooks, creating a more streamlined workflow and enhancing productivity. In this article, we will explore the various methods to connect one Excel file to another, ensuring you can easily manage your data for personal or professional use.

Understanding External References in Excel

Before diving into the methods of connecting Excel files, it’s important to understand what an external reference is. An external reference in Excel allows you to refer to cells, ranges, or even entire worksheets that are located in another workbook. This is invaluable for businesses and individuals who need to work with large datasets spread across multiple files.

By using external references, you can have a central workbook that consolidates data from various sources without the need for manual updates. When the source data changes, the central workbook can automatically reflect those changes, ensuring you are always working with the most current information.

The Basic Syntax of External References

When creating an external reference in Excel, the basic syntax looks like this:

=[WorkbookName]SheetName!CellAddress

Here, it’s crucial to note the following:
WorkbookName: The name of the Excel file you want to connect to (ensure it includes the extension, like .xlsx).
SheetName: The name of the worksheet where the data is found.
CellAddress: The specific cell you want to reference (e.g., A1).

Methods to Connect Excel Files

Now that you understand external references, let’s take a closer look at the various methods to connect one Excel file to another, using both manual and automated approaches.

1. Linking Data Manually

Manual linking is the simplest way to connect Excel files, and it’s particularly effective when you need a small amount of data from another workbook. Follow these steps:

Step 1: Open Both Workbooks

Start by opening both the source workbook (the one that contains the data) and the destination workbook (the one you want to feed the data into).

Step 2: Create the Link

  1. In the destination workbook, select the cell where you want to display the data.
  2. Type the equals sign =.
  3. Switch to the source workbook, navigate to the sheet with the desired data, and click on the cell you want to reference.
  4. Press Enter.

Excel will automatically create an external reference to the source cell. The formula will look something like this:

='[SourceWorkbook.xlsx]Sheet1'!A1

Step 3: Save Both Workbooks

To ensure the links are preserved, save both workbooks after creating your connections.

2. Using the Data Import Function

For those who require larger datasets or want to import a table, Excel’s data import feature is ideal. This method creates a connection that can be refreshed as needed.

Step 1: Open the Destination Workbook

Begin by opening the destination workbook where you want to import the data.

Step 2: Navigate to Data Tab

  1. Click on the Data tab in the Excel ribbon.
  2. Select Get Data > From File > From Workbook.

Step 3: Choose the Source Workbook

Navigate to the location of the source Excel file and select it.

Step 4: Select Data to Import

You’ll be prompted to select the specific table or range you want to import. Choose the desired table or range and click Load.

Excel will now create a linked table in your destination workbook. Any updates made in the source file can be refreshed in the destination workbook through the Refresh feature.

3. Utilizing Power Query for Advanced Connections

For users who regularly work with data across multiple Excel files, Excel’s Power Query feature is a powerful tool. It allows for significant customization and automation of your data connections.

Step 1: Open Power Query

Begin by opening the destination workbook and go to the Data tab. From there, click on Get Data > From File > From Workbook.

Step 2: Navigate and Import

Select your source Excel file. In the Navigator pane, you will see the available tables and ranges. Choose the specific table you want and click Load.

Step 3: Transform Data (Optional)

If needed, you can also click on Transform Data to enter the Power Query Editor. Here, you can perform numerous modifications on your data, such as filtering rows, changing data types, or even merging multiple tables.

Step 4: Load the Data

After making any desired changes, click Close & Load. The connected data will now appear in your destination workbook. Any changes in the source file can be updated easily by right-clicking on your table and selecting Refresh.

Best Practices for Linking Excel Files

While connecting Excel files is relatively straightforward, there are some best practices to keep in mind to ensure efficiency and accuracy:

1. Use Clear Naming Conventions

Maintaining clear, descriptive names for your workbooks and sheets can save time and reduce errors when creating links. Use meaningful names that reflect the data contained within.

2. Keep Source Files Organized

Store your source files in an organized manner. This could involve having a dedicated folder for all related Excel files. This not only helps in easy access but also minimizes broken links.

3. Regularly Check for Updates

If you’re working with dynamic data, the source files may change frequently. Regularly refreshing your connections or schedules for updates can help maintain data accuracy.

4. Document Your Connections

Consider keeping a separate document that outlines the connections between different Excel files, especially if you are working on complex projects. This can serve as a reference for yourself and others who might use your files in the future.

Troubleshooting Common Issues

Even with the best intentions, connecting Excel files can occasionally lead to problems. Here are some common issues and how to address them:

1. Broken Links

Broken links occur when the source file is moved, renamed, or deleted. To fix this:
– Go to Data > Edit Links to update the source file path.

2. Calculation Errors

Sometimes, external references may lead to calculation errors, especially if data types do not match. Verify the data types in both workbooks to ensure that they are compatible.

3. Slow Performance

If you have numerous external links, this can hinder the performance of your Excel file. Consider consolidating data or using other methods to manage large datasets more efficiently.

Conclusion

Connecting one Excel file to another is a fundamental skill that can significantly enhance your data management capabilities. With techniques ranging from manual links to Power Query, Excel provides you with powerful ways to consolidate and manage your data effectively.

By following the methods outlined in this article, you can create a dynamic and interconnected workflow that keeps your files updated and relevant. Whether for personal projects or professional endeavors, mastering these connections in Excel will streamline your operations and ensure you have the right data at your fingertips.

Arming yourself with these skills will not only save you time but also empower you to work smarter, not harder. Start exploring the connections in your Excel workbooks today!

What does it mean to connect one Excel file to another?

Connecting one Excel file to another refers to the process of linking data between two separate workbooks in Microsoft Excel. This allows users to reference and display data from one workbook in another without having to duplicate the data. By creating connections, any updates made to the source workbook can automatically reflect in the destination workbook, ensuring consistency and accuracy in data reporting.

This process is particularly useful for collaborative projects, large datasets, or when working with historical data stored in different files. Overall, it enhances efficiency and minimizes the need for manual data entry, which can be error-prone.

How do I create a link between two Excel files?

To create a link between two Excel files, first open both workbooks that you want to connect. In the destination workbook, select the cell where you wish the linked data to appear. You can then type an equal sign (=) followed by navigating to the source workbook and selecting the cell that contains the data you want to link. After selecting the cell, press Enter and Excel will automatically create a formula that links the two files.

Ensure that both workbooks are saved in a location that you can easily access. If you move either file after creating the link, you may need to update the link to maintain data integrity. You can find and manage your links by using the “Edit Links” feature under the Data tab in Excel.

What types of connections can I establish in Excel?

In Excel, you can establish several types of connections, such as simple cell references, named ranges, or even more complex connections involving data from external databases. A simple connection usually involves linking a cell or a range in one workbook to another. Named ranges allow you to define a specific name for a set of cells, making it easier to reference this data in your formulas.

Additionally, for advanced users, Excel supports connections to ODBC-compliant databases, such as SQL Server or Access. You can also import data from external sources like text files or cloud-based data sources, allowing for a more complex integration of data across platforms. This versatility allows users to tailor data connections to their specific needs.

Can I link data from a closed Excel file?

Yes, you can link data from a closed Excel file. When creating a link to a closed workbook, you need to specify the full file path along with the sheet name and cell reference in your formula. The syntax for this is: '[Filename.xlsx]SheetName'!CellReference. This method allows you to pull data into your active workbook even when the source workbook is not open.

However, be aware that if the source file is moved or renamed, the link will break, and Excel may prompt you to update the link or locate the file again. Additionally, while you can view the linked data, some functionalities may be limited compared to when the source file is open.

What is the difference between linking and embedding data in Excel?

Linking and embedding are two different methods of incorporating data from other sources into an Excel workbook. When you link data, you create a reference to the original data that remains in its source location. Consequently, changes made to the original data will automatically update in the linked Excel file. This keeps your data current without the need for manual updates.

On the other hand, embedding data means you are incorporating a copy of the data directly into your workbook. This approach makes the data self-contained, meaning it won’t update if the original data changes. Therefore, while embedding is useful for maintaining a static snapshot, linking is preferable for dynamic data that requires ongoing updates.

What should I do if my linked data doesn’t update?

If your linked data in Excel isn’t updating as expected, there are a few troubleshooting steps you can take. First, ensure that the source workbook is accessible and hasn’t been moved or renamed. If the source file is closed, ensure you have the correct file path and the appropriate permissions to access it. You can check the link status under the “Edit Links” option in the Data tab.

Another common reason for links not updating is Excel’s settings. Excel may not automatically update links when opening a workbook for security reasons. To check this, go to File > Options > Trust Center > Trust Center Settings > External Content and make sure “Enable Automatic Update of Links” is selected. Be aware that enabling this may expose your workbook to external changes that you may not want.

How can I break or remove a link between two Excel files?

Breaking or removing a link between two Excel files is a straightforward process in Excel. To do this, navigate to the Data tab and select the “Edit Links” option. This will open a dialog box displaying all the external links in your workbook. Here, you can select the link you wish to break and click on the “Break Link” button. After confirming the action, the link will be broken and the data will remain in your workbook as static values.

Keep in mind that when you break a link, any dynamic updates will cease. The data that was previously linked will not change if the source file is updated. Therefore, it is wise to create a backup of your workbook before breaking any links, ensuring you do not lose any necessary reference data.

Are there any limitations to connecting Excel files?

Yes, there are several limitations to consider when connecting Excel files. One significant limitation is that linked workbooks must be compatible in terms of versions and functionality. For example, some features available in newer versions of Excel may not work correctly in older versions. Consequently, collaborative projects might encounter issues if team members are using different versions of the software.

Additionally, Excel has a limit on the number of links that can be created between workbooks, and performance may degrade if too many links exist, potentially causing lag or crashing when opening or processing linked data. It is also essential to remember that complex formulas and large datasets can increase the risk of errors and may lead to data integrity issues if not managed correctly.

Leave a Comment